About Manordene

Manordene is a nursing home in Sevenoaks, in the Kent council area, registered with the Care Quality Commission for up to 22 residents. It provides care for people living with dementia, older people, younger adults and people with a physical disability. It is run by Manorville Care Homes. The home has been registered since March 2013.

At its latest inspection, published October 2025, the CQC rated Manordene Inadequate, which means the CQC found the service performing badly and has taken enforcement action. Ratings can change after a new inspection, so check the CQC report before you visit.

Manordene has not published its fees and has not yet confirmed them to us. Care homes in Kent with a fee on record typically charge about £1,500 a week for residential care and £1,550 for nursing care, so expect a figure in that range and ask the home for a written quote.

There are 499 registered care homes in Kent. The nearest to Manordene include Holywell Park, Fairby Grange and Eglantine Villa Care Home, 2 of which have a fee on record. A live-in carer at home, an alternative many families compare, costs from about £1,120 a week.
